Ingredients
- 1.5 lbs chicken thighs
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 tsp smoked paprika
- 1/2 tsp cumin
- 1/4 tsp garlic powder
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 1 lemon
- 2 tbsp fresh parsley
- 2 tbsp fresh dill
Instructions
- Step 1: Pat chicken thighs dry with paper towels, then season evenly with 1 tsp smoked paprika, 1/2 tsp cumin, 1/4 tsp garlic powder, 1/4 tsp salt, and 1/4 tsp black pepper.
- Step 2: Heat 2 tbsp olive oil in a large oven-safe sk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ering. Add chicken skin-side down and cook undisturbed for 8 minutes until golden brown.
- Step 3: Flip chicken, transfer skillet to preheated 400°F oven, and bake for 20-25 minutes until internal temperature reaches 165°F.
- Step 4: Remove chicken, pour off excess fat, then add 1 lemon (zested and juiced) and 2 tbsp fresh parsley to the skillet. Simmer for 2 minutes until sauce thickens slightly.
- Step 5: Slice chicken and serve with sauce spooned over top, garnished with 2 tbsp fresh dill.

How do I scale Johnson's Spiced Chicken with Lemon-Herb Sauce for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
